diff --git a/main.py b/main.py index 8a96dd3..94f636b 100644 --- a/main.py +++ b/main.py @@ -26,6 +26,7 @@ from settings.blueprint import blueprint as settings_blueprint from settings.service import SettingService from user.blueprint import blueprint as user_blueprint +from flask_cors import CORS # load env load_env() @@ -36,6 +37,8 @@ __name__, static_folder="static", template_folder="static", static_url_path="" ) +# CORS setup +CORS(app) # create logger app.logger = create_logger(app) @@ -50,6 +53,8 @@ ) + + # initialize database init_db() diff --git a/requirements.txt b/requirements.txt index 75a51c0..6402bc7 100644 --- a/requirements.txt +++ b/requirements.txt @@ -10,6 +10,7 @@ commonmark==0.9.1 Deprecated==1.2.13 dill==0.3.5.1 Flask==2.2.2 +Flask-Cors==3.0.10 Flask-Limiter==2.7.0 Flask-SocketIO==5.3.1 greenlet==1.1.3 @@ -38,6 +39,7 @@ python-engineio==4.3.4 python-socketio==5.7.1 requests==2.28.1 rich==12.6.0 +six==1.16.0 SQLAlchemy==1.4.41 stripe==4.1.0 toml==0.10.2